My client is currently in the market for an experienced Health and Safety Advisor to join their team and work on a large Highways project.
Key Responsibilities:
- Actively promote Safety, Health and Environmental aspects leading and setting a good example to other employees and stakeholders.
- Work closely with the operational teams in carrying out their roles and SHE responsibilities.
- Provide timely and affective operational SHE support and advice to the business unit.
- Assist the operational teams in developing Risk Assessments and Safe Systems of Work.
- Support the operational teams in developing and reviews RAMS.
- Conduct regular and robust Health and Safety Inspections & Audits.
- Ensure all accidents, incidents and near misses are reported quickly and are also effectively investigated, contributing to Incident Review Boards and Incident Review Panels.
- Ensure operational compliance to approved SHE procedures.
- Ensure that all SHE reporting requirements are provided accurately and in a timely manner.
- Assist Management teams in the development of Health and Safety related documents.
- Advise and assist in the identification of Health and Safety training requirements.
- Undertake and plan D&A Testing.
Key Accountabilities:
- To implement and comply with all legal requirements, Safety Management Systems, Client requirements and best practice.
- Ensure the Group is compliant with all SHE: statutory requirements, accredited processes and procedures, and contract specific requirements.
- Manage the reporting and review of SHE accidents / incidents on the contract.
- Support the assessment of staff to ensure capacity, capability and competency are maintained.
- Comply with HR policies, procedures, and Values.
- Ensure all new starters are inducted appropriately.
Essential:
- Previous highways project experience as a Health and Safety Advisor is a must
- NEBOSH Certificate (preferably Construction) or equivalent.
- Membership of relevant professional institution (e.g., Tech IOSH or above).
- Environmental qualification (IEMA or equivalent).
- Auditing qualification.
- Full UK Driving Licence.
